Often misunderstood, "marketing" is not a euphemism for advertising or selling, rather, it is a whole approach to business. It relates an organization to its market and ultimately brings in business. Marketing Stripped Bare demystifies the process, explaining what marketing is and why it's so important.

Have you ever noticed how all the buzzwords, trends, and "latest thinking" on management have very little to do with how things work in the real world? Seemingly every year, the management gurus dress their wisdom in the latest jargon, but it's been awhile since somebody shouted, "The emperor has no clothes!" Today, that somebody is Jo Owen, who has seen it all in his more than twenty years working with organizations of all types and sizes, including some of the world's most respected corporations. Management Stripped Bare is Owen's A-to-Z recounting of what he has learned (and now teaches) about how businesses actually operate. With dry and occasionally piercing humor, Owen examines the good, the bad, and the ugly of more than 150 universal management issues from leadership to accounting practices, performance appraisal to harassment policy, mergers & acquisitions to project management, and much more. Among his less traditional subjects are herd instincts, "-ists," blame, Mars Bars, the death of the Tea Lady (read the book!), and why attrition and stress are good. For novice and veteran managers disillusioned by blind faith in sacred cows, Jo Owen serves up the juiciest burgers in town. And while it's amazing that someone with tongue so firmly planted in cheek can speak so clearly, more impressive is the wealth of real solutions you'll be able to apply in your own work environment. This is a book about business as it is - not as it should be. Managers face the same problems the world over - bad meetings, boring presentations, unreasonable expectations, difficult bosses - and somehow they are meant to make sense of it all. But this isn't taught in business school. In Management Stripped Bare Jo Owen draws on his vast experience to present real-life solutions and observations on common management challenges. Each challenge is described, and successful and unsuccessful responses are illustrated with case studies. Punchy, edgy and refreshingly honest, it is entertaining and witty as well as informative. Irreverent and incisive, Management Stripped Bare cuts through the usual management hype and rhetoric to reveal what business is really about. It is not a grand theory of management but a practical guide to survival in the real world.

A woman disappears. Her car lies abandoned on a remote bluff; no body is found. Known by her family and friends as quiet and self-contained, she has left behind an incendiary diary chronicling a disturbing journey of sexual awakening. The diary opens on her honeymoon in Morocco: she believes herself to be happy—or happy enough, anyway. Swiftly, this security masquerading as love fractures in an act of massive betrayal, only to propel her into a world of desire and fantasy and recklessness. In need of guidance, she finds an unlikely heroine in the anonymous author of a dusty, rare manuscript. Written by a woman in the 1600s, it is a cry from the heart for women to live and love freely. Emboldened, she allows herself to discover the intoxicating power of knowing what she wants and how to get it. The question is, how long can her soul sustain a perilous double life? Coolly impassioned, Bride Stripped Bare tells shocking truths about love and sex. Couched in a deceptively simple style, its gorgeous, incantatory rhythms will make you question whether it is ever entirely possible to know another person.
